The Hong Kong Court of Appeal, in a 2-1 majority, quashed the Communications Authority’s findings against Radio Television Hong Kong (RTHK) for breaching the media code on Wednesday. A former aide to New York Governor Kathy Hochul was arrested Tuesday alongside her husband on charges of acting as an agent of the Chinese government. Hong Kong police officials arrested two individuals on Saturday under the new national security law, citing alleged “seditious” intent. The detainees include a 41-year-old man and a 28-year-old woman, who are suspected of forging a suicide note of a deceased professor to allegedly incite hatred against the Hong Kong and central (Chinese) government. The Hong Kong District Court on Thursday found Best Pencil (Hong Kong Limited), the parent company of Stand News, along with former chief editor Chung Pui-kuen and former acting chief editor Patrick Lam, guilty of “conspiracy to publish and/or reproduce seditious publications” under the now-repealed section 10(1)(c) of the Crimes Ordinance. Former Hong Kong district councilor Ng Kin-wai said on Tuesday that he was not remorseful for participating in an alleged conspiracy to subvert state power by controlling the 2020 Legislative Council election, according to local media. The Hong Kong Court of Final Appeal dismissed the appeals brought by seven activists, including businessman Jimmy Lai, against their unauthorized assembly convictions on Monday.
